Charles Hicks, Sr. Obituary

Charles Edward Hicks, Sr. was welcomed into the Kingdom of Heaven on Friday, September 14, 2018. He was 71 years young. Charles was born at his home in Maury City, Tennessee, the child of Burnice Hicks and Norma Ray Midgett Hicks. Charles is survived by his loving wife of 50 plus years Sandra (Taylor) Hicks. The second of seven brothers, Charles was preceded in death by his brothers, Nolen Hicks (Thelma) and James Midgett (Margaret). Surviving Charles are his brothers, John (Mary), Michael (Bernetta), Solomon (Regina) and Willie (Shirley).

Charles is the father of two children, Kimberly Hicks Lewis (William) and Charles Edward Hicks, Jr. (Connie). Kimberly preceded her father in death. He is also survived by his 12 grandchildren, Charlize, Charles Ethan, Christina, Camryn, Grant, Hamilton, Konner, Harper, Isiah, Graceson, Zachary and Kathleen. 

Charles was a ‘country boy’ at heart, he grew up farming and loved the outdoors. He graduated from Central High School in Alamo, TN, in 1965. After high school, Charles attended Tennessee State University graduating with a bachelor’s degree in plant sciences. While attending college, Charles served his country in Vietnam as a U.S. Army paratrooper earning a Silver Star. Upon his return from Vietnam, Charles eventually began his tenure at CSX Transportation, rising to become Director of Environmental Operations for the entire East Coast. Charles worked for CSX for 30 plus years.

An active member of the Phillip R. Cousin A.M.E. Church, Charles served as a protem, steward, and with the Sons of Allen for several years. Charles was also an advisor on the construction and design of the new worship center built in 2006. A great philanthropist, Charles was involved with programs such as Habitat for Humanity and UCOM. Charles was the epitome of excellence and class, a loving husband, father, granddaddy, a great provider for his family, role model, and a devout man of God. Charles will be missed so much by his family, friends and former colleagues.
